How do you explain error propagation?

Error propagation (or propagation of uncertainty) is what happens to measurement errors when you use those uncertain measurements to calculate something else. For example, you might use velocity to calculate kinetic energy, or you might use length to calculate area.

What is propagation of error in physics class 11?

Propagation of Errors in Product: Thus, when a result involves the product of two observed quantities, the relative error in the result is equal to the sum of the relative error in the observed quantities.

How does error propagate in addition?

In words, this says that the error in the result of an addition or subtraction is the square root of the sum of the squares of the errors in the quantities being added or subtracted. This mathematical procedure, also used in Pythagoras’ theorem about right triangles, is called quadrature.

What is random error in physics?

Random errors in experimental measurements are caused by unknown and unpredictable changes in the experiment. These changes may occur in the measuring instruments or in the environmental conditions.

What is propagated in wave motion?

wave motion, propagation of disturbances—that is, deviations from a state of rest or equilibrium—from place to place in a regular and organized way. Most familiar are surface waves on water, but both sound and light travel as wavelike disturbances, and the motion of all subatomic particles exhibits wavelike properties.

What is random and systematic error?

Random errors are (like the name suggests) completely random. They are unpredictable and can’t be replicated by repeating the experiment again. Systematic Errors produce consistent errors, either a fixed amount (like 1 lb) or a proportion (like 105% of the true value).

What is an indeterminate error?

Random Error (indeterminate error) Caused by uncontrollable variables, which can not be defined/eliminated.

What is determinate error?

Systematic Error (determinate error) The error is reproducible and can be discovered and corrected. Random Error (indeterminate error) Caused by uncontrollable variables, which can not be defined/eliminated.

How to calculate propagation of error?

Propagation of Errors in Subtraction: Suppose a result x is obtained by subtraction of two quantities say a and b. i.e. x = a – b. Let Δ a and Δ b are absolute errors in the measurement of a and b and Δ x be the corresponding absolute error in x. ∴ x ± Δ x = ( a ± Δ a) – ( b ± Δ b) ∴ x ± Δ x = ( a – b ) ± Δ a – + Δ b.
